Japanese Wakizashi, Mumei (Unsigned)
Edo Period
Japanese wakizashi mumei, in very good polish and very nice ji hada, ideal for a new collectors that wants to own a real samurai sword of great quality without spend big money. Officially registered in Japan, preserved in a plain wooden shirasaya, designed solely for blade protection and long-term conservation.
The blade shows a natural, gentle curvature, consistent with functional Edo-period production. The steel displays an honest aged patina, with traces of historical use and traditional polishing, free from modern cosmetic restoration. The hamon is subtle and integrated into the ji, visible under proper lighting, reinforcing the impression of a blade made for real use rather than modern display.
The nakago is well preserved, with stable dark patina, one mekugi-ana, and no signature — a common feature in utilitarian wakizashi. No signs of recent alteration or artificial enhancement are present.
The shirasaya fulfills its role perfectly: protection, stability, and respect for the blade.
